Dealers across the country are starting to recieve their shipments of the first Shelby GT500’s off the assembly line. One in particular is Texas Toys in Houston which from what I can see is not a Ford dealership but some sort of used car dealer who sells high price autos. I am not sure how they got their hands on one but they did and they are auctioning it off on Ebay like all the other dealers. What sets them apart from most of the auctions on Ebay is they have the GT500 in hand and on thier lot probably in some type of protective custody. On their website they list the price at $75K but on Ebay as of writing this the auction has only reached $53K.
